In the fast-evolving landscape of cryptocurrency, the role of API providers for crypto developers has never been more pivotal. As the digital currency space continues to expand, developers are tasked with creating robust, secure, and efficient applications that cater to a global audience. To meet these demands, understanding and leveraging the right API providers is crucial.

The Essence of API Providers

APIs, or Application Programming Interfaces, act as the bridge between different software systems, allowing them to communicate and share data seamlessly. In the context of cryptocurrency, APIs play an indispensable role in enabling developers to integrate blockchain functionalities into their applications without having to manage the underlying complexities of blockchain technology.

Why APIs are Essential

Simplification of Complex Processes: Blockchain technology, with its intricate consensus mechanisms and cryptographic protocols, is inherently complex. APIs abstract these complexities, providing developers with straightforward interfaces to interact with blockchain networks. This simplifies the development process, allowing developers to focus on building innovative features rather than grappling with technical intricacies.

Enhanced Security: Security is paramount in cryptocurrency development. API providers often offer built-in security features such as two-factor authentication, encryption, and secure key management. These features help developers to create secure applications that protect user data and assets from potential threats.

Efficiency and Speed: By leveraging APIs, developers can significantly reduce the time and effort required to implement blockchain functionalities. This not only accelerates development cycles but also ensures that applications are up-to-date with the latest blockchain standards and protocols.

Top API Providers for Crypto Developers

Chainlink

Chainlink is renowned for its decentralized oracle services, which enable smart contracts to interact with external data sources. Chainlink's API providers offer robust solutions for fetching real-world data securely, making it an invaluable tool for applications that require real-time information.

BlockCypher

BlockCypher offers a suite of APIs that facilitate blockchain integration across various platforms. From managing wallets to executing transactions, BlockCypher’s APIs provide comprehensive solutions for developers looking to incorporate blockchain functionalities into their applications.

Coinbase Commerce

Coinbase Commerce simplifies the process of accepting cryptocurrency payments. Their APIs allow businesses to integrate payment processing with minimal setup, making it easier to offer crypto payments to customers worldwide.

CryptoCompare

CryptoCompare provides real-time market data, historical prices, and market trends through its API services. This data is crucial for applications that require market insights, such as trading platforms and portfolio management tools.

Nexo

Nexo’s API services offer liquidity solutions, allowing developers to integrate lending and borrowing features into their applications. With access to competitive interest rates, Nexo’s APIs enable the creation of decentralized finance (DeFi) applications that offer users innovative financial services.

Choosing the Right API Provider

Selecting the right API provider involves considering several factors:

Security: Ensure the provider offers strong security features to protect your application and users.

Reliability: Look for providers with a proven track record of reliability and uptime.

Ease of Integration: An API that is easy to integrate will save time and reduce complexity.

Support and Documentation: Comprehensive documentation and responsive support can make a significant difference in troubleshooting and optimizing your application.

Cost: Evaluate the pricing structure to ensure it fits within your budget and offers value for the features provided.

Practical Applications

APIs from these providers can be utilized in various ways:

Wallet Management: APIs can be used to manage digital wallets, allowing users to store, send, and receive cryptocurrencies securely.

Transaction Processing: APIs facilitate the execution of transactions on blockchain networks, enabling the creation of payment solutions and trading platforms.

Market Data Integration: APIs that provide real-time market data can be integrated into applications to offer insights into market trends and prices.

DeFi Solutions: APIs can be leveraged to build decentralized finance applications, offering lending, borrowing, and yield farming services.
